Applications are invited for a postdoctoral research fellow to work on the development and application of computational biology methods for investigating biomolecular interactions and computer-aided drug design. The emphasis is on modelign and design of antimicrobial peptides as well as on modeling of complement proteins, their interactions and design of complement activation inhibitors.
The project is advised by Professor Yiannis Kaznessis of Chemical Engineering and Materials Science and is funded by the National Institutes of Health. CEMS is a top Chemical Engineering Department, according to the National Research Council (number one) and the US News and World Report (number four).
A Ph.D. or equivalent in chemical engineering, chemistry, biochemistry, bioengineering, bioinformatics, computational biology, biophysics or related field is required.
A strong background in biophysics with excellent computational skills and experience in biomolecular simulations are essential. Free energy calculations experience a plus. Experience with biomolecular simulation packages and protein-ligand and protein-protein docking methods is also a plus.
The appointment will be for one year, and will be renewable for a second and a third year.
